Significance of Probate Bonds



Why are probate bonds important for protecting your enjoyed ones in lawful matters?

Probate bonds play a crucial duty in making sure that the dreams detailed in a will are performed effectively and with no mismanagement of possessions. By requiring the executor of an estate to acquire a probate bond, the court includes an extra layer of protection for the beneficiaries involved.

In https://mb.com.ph/2020/11/09/bir-warns-on-fake-surety-bonds/ that the executor fails to satisfy their duties or messes up the estate's assets, the probate bond gives a form of economic option for the recipients. This bond serves as a protect, assuring that the recipients will obtain their rightful inheritances as defined in the will.

Without probate bonds, the beneficiaries could be left vulnerable to prospective scams, mismanagement, or mistakes in the administration of the estate. For that reason, having probate bonds in position is vital for safeguarding the interests and well-being of your loved ones throughout the probate process.

Types of Probate Bonds



To much better understand exactly how to safeguard your liked ones with probate bonds, it is necessary to comprehend the different sorts of probate bonds readily available.

There are primarily three kinds of probate bonds: administrator bonds, administrator bonds, and guardian bonds. Administrator bonds are needed when a person passes away without a will, and the court designates a manager to take care of the estate. Administrator bonds, on the other hand, are required when a will remains in area, and the court selects an administrator to carry out the deceased person's wishes. Last but not least, guardian bonds are necessary when an individual is appointed as the legal guardian of a minor or incapacitated person.
